The Blue-and-Orange Problem in Home Services Marketing
Scroll through local service ads for plumbing, sewer repair, or trenchless services and a pattern appears almost immediately. Bright royal blue. Safety orange. Bold block lettering. Nearly identical layouts. Similar truck wraps. Similar logos. Similar visual tone.
After a while, every company starts blending together.
For trenchless contractors trying to improve local visibility and brand recall, that creates a serious problem. If homeowners cannot quickly distinguish your company from five nearly identical competitors, your marketing becomes easier to overlook no matter how strong your service quality may be.

Most Home Service Brands Follow the Same Visual Formula
Many contractors choose blue and orange because those colors traditionally signal:
- Trust
- Visibility
- Safety
- Industrial professionalism
There is nothing inherently wrong with those associations.
The problem happens when entire local markets begin using nearly identical visual systems.
Customers Make Fast Visual Judgments
Research from the University of Loyola Maryland suggests color can significantly influence brand recognition and first impressions.
When homeowners quickly scan:
- Google Local Services Ads
- Google Maps results
- Fleet vehicles
- Social media profiles
- Websites
they often rely on visual shortcuts to decide which businesses feel memorable, modern, or trustworthy.
If every company looks the same, customers have fewer reasons to remember yours specifically.

Deep Slate Gray and Lime Green
This combination often communicates:
- Modern professionalism
- Technical precision
- Energy
- Visibility without aggressiveness
The lime accent still creates high contrast and visibility while avoiding the overused orange-and-blue pattern.
Matte Black and Metallic Silver
This palette often feels:
- Premium
- Clean
- Industrial
- Sophisticated
For companies wanting a more high-end positioning strategy, darker neutral tones can create stronger visual distinction.
Earth Tones and Dark Greens
These combinations may reinforce:
- Environmental awareness
- Property protection
- Stability
- Outdoor service relevance
This can work especially well for trenchless contractors emphasizing minimal landscape disruption.

Professional Does Not Have to Mean Generic
Some contractors worry alternative branding may appear less professional or less trustworthy.
In reality, strong branding depends more on consistency and execution than on using traditional colors.
Strong Industrial Branding Usually Includes:
High Contrast
Logos and vehicle wraps should remain readable from distance.
Consistent Typography
Simple, bold typefaces often work best for service industries.
Limited Color Complexity
Too many colors can weaken visual recognition.
Scalable Logo Design
Your branding should remain clear across:
- Websites
- Trucks
- Shirts
- Ads
- Social media icons

Common Branding Mistakes That Hurt Visibility
Copying Competitor Branding Too Closely
Following industry trends too aggressively often weakens differentiation.
Prioritizing Trends Over Functionality
Some logos may look visually impressive but perform poorly on:
- Trucks
- Uniforms
- Small screens
- Yard signs
Using Too Many Colors
Overly complex palettes can reduce readability and consistency.
Ignoring Long-Term Scalability
Branding should remain effective as your company grows across:
- New service areas
- Additional crews
- Expanded marketing channels
